Miitomo Has Officially Launched in US

Nintendo’s first smartphone/tablet game, Miitomo, has officially launched in the US after an announcement was made just a few days ago by the company. The app has become very popular in Japan where the game initially launched, making it the #1 free app to download in the Japanese Google Play and App Store markets.

The countries where Miitomo is now available are as follows:

US, Australia, Austria, Belgium, Canada, France, Germany, Ireland, Italy, Japan, Luxembourg, Netherlands, New Zealand, Russia, Spain, and United Kingdom

Miitomo doesn’t feature any of the familiar faces like Super Mario we’ve all come to know and love, however it does feature the ever-so-popular Mii customizable characters found on the Wii and Nintendo DS counsels. Users can create their own Mii which will be used throughout the app. Once the initial signup and creation of your Mii is done, you’ll be able to chat with other users signed up for the application with them seeing any information you’ve decided to add to your Mii’s profile. Nintendo claims that your Mii one day will soon know more about you than you do yourself as you keep adding more and more information to it along with the messages you send to specific people.

“With Miitomo, Nintendo takes its first step into the world of smart devices,” said Scott Moffitt, Nintendo of America’s Executive Vice President of Sales & Marketing. “Miitomo brings the special Nintendo charm and polish that people around the world love to an entirely new format and audience.”
